What is the take-home pay on €120,000 in France?
On €120,000 gross in France, your take-home pay is €74,833 per year — 37.6% of gross, after tax and social contributions.

Where your money goes
| Item | Annual | % of gross |
|---|---|---|
| Gross salary | €120,000.00 | 100.0% |
| − Social Charges | €26,400.00 | 22.0% |
| − Income Tax | €18,767.12 | 15.6% |
| = Take-home | €74,832.88 | 62.4% |
Effective tax rate: 37.6% · Marginal rate: 50.8%
